Output 670526414d39304ca67ec7eb3236294884f0645eb1d15f1697c6009f95593325: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feaec3e8ded2c064c7797b49f30efbb174936110 OP_EQUALVERIFY OP_CHECKSIG
address
1QDdzdUenCQLRd49QZkM92omeMRoLEYVqB
transaction
670526414d39304ca67ec7eb3236294884f0645eb1d15f1697c6009f95593325
spent
true